Parent Review of Proposed YCSD Community Service Recognition Program

Posted On: Thursday, November 18, 2010
Goal 4 of the York County School Division Strategic Plan includes development of a Citizenship/Community Service Objective that is designed to increase student involvement in citizenship and community service activities that are completed by students prior to graduation. A proposal has been created and is designed to recognize students who complete at least 200 hours of community service during their 9th through 12th grade years. The proposed recognition includes graduates receiving a community service diploma seal and an opportunity to purchase a cord to wear at graduation. The proposal will be made available for review on Monday, November 22nd, in Conference Room C at the School Board Office (302 Dare Road, Yorktown) from 3:00 to 6:00 p.m.
